Man Arrested After Texting and Driving in Trenton

The following information was supplied by the Trenton Police Department. Where arrests or charges are mentioned, it does not indicate a conviction.

Trenton police arrested a 20-year-old man for possession of marijuana during a traffic stop in which the man was pulled over after texting and driving at about 1:30 a.m. March 30 on Fort Street near Emeline Avenue.

The man told police the reason his vehicle crossed the fog line on Fort Street near Marian and crossed the center line three times between Norwood Street and Van Horn Road was he was texting.

The man said, "I was texting, sorry. You can even check my messages," according to a Trenton police report.

The officer who pulled the man's vehicle over said he could smell a strong odor of marijuanna and asked the man where it was, to which the man replied, "It's in the center console," according to the same report.

Police found a prescription pill bottle containing marijuana in the center console.

The man was arrested and transported to the Trenton Police Department, where he was issued a citation for possession of marijuana and a civil infraction for texting and driving.
